UEFA President Michel Platini believes the 2014 Ballon d’Or should not go to either Cristiano Ronaldo or Lionel Messi. In an interview with BeIN Sports, the Frenchmansaid the award should be won by a member of the German national team that won the World Cup in Brazil this summer. “The Ballon d’Or usually goes to a player who has performed exceptionallywell at the World Cup, someone who won it, so this year that should be a German player,” the Frenchman said. However, he later conceded that there is no one in the world who can match eitherMessi or Ronaldo. “Nobody can argue with that,” he said.
